No proposal for 9,000 square feet minister flats submitted: Energy Adviser
No proposal over the construction of 9,000 square feet flats for ministers have been placed before the Advisers Council Committee on Government Purchase, said Power, Energy and Mineral Resources Adviser Muhammad Fouzul Kabir Khan on Tuesday.
“I have not seen any such proposal. I do not understand where this information is coming from. No such proposal has come to the purchase committee,” he told reporters after meeting of Advisers Council Committee on Government Purchase and Committee on Economic Affairs at the Secretariat.
He said any project involving such a significant expenditure would necessarily have to be placed before the Purchase Committee.

Such matter has not been discussed at the committee level, he said responding to a question over the media report on flat construction.
When journalists pointed out that the initiative reportedly originated from the Ministry of Housing and Public Works, the adviser said any such proposal would have to go through the proper process.
“They may be preparing something at their level but a project involving such a large amount of money must come to the purchase committee. I attend every purchase committee meeting and I do not recall any such proposal being placed,” he said.
